I thought I would keep everybody updated on my training for Great Floridian. The race is an iron-distance triathlon in Clermont, Florida on Saturday, October 20th. I just finished my first week of training in a 24 week training plan. The plan calls for 10 workouts a week. 3 swims, 3 bikes, 3 runs, 1 brick. I will very likely be straying from the plan regularly but I like to have a structured training plan in place either way. I will be training 6 days a week and taking Monday off for most weeks.
Week 1
Mon PM – 40:00 Run
Tue AM – 1:00:00 Stationary Bike
Wed PM – 50:00 Run to Pool, 40:00 Swim (1550 yards), 20:00 Run home
Thu PM – 45:00 Stationary Bike, 15:00 Transition Run
Fri PM – 1:05:00 Run
Sat – ( AM) 2:15:00 Stationary Bike, (PM) 35:00 Swim (1500 yards)
Sun afternoon – 1:20:00 Run
Total: 8 workouts – – – 2 swims, 2 Bike, 3 Run, 1 Brick
Total Time – – – 9:45:00
